Hyperliquid has recorded a brand new milestone, with open curiosity in conventional asset markets (HIP-3) surpassing $4.13 billion for the primary time, based on Hyperscreener ASXN. In the meantime, every day buying and selling quantity noticed a rare leap, hovering 229% to $4.87 billion and totally exceeding the quantity of capital held on the platform.
Whereas conventional inventory exchanges are closed, crypto merchants are shifting en masse from memecoin hypothesis to 24/7 buying and selling in tokenized shares, commodities and indices on blockchain rails.
Contracts tied to shares of reminiscence chip producers SK Hynix and Micron Expertise surged into the top-traded markets, permitting merchants to react immediately to in a single day information.

The principle supply of disruption within the equities part over the previous 24 hours was Palantir (PLTR), whose explosive 25.86% achieve topped the record of the day’s finest performers. This transfer triggered a significant wipeout of leveraged positions, inflicting every day liquidations throughout markets deployed by xyz to leap 544% and exceed $19.25 million.
Nevertheless, this new Hyperliquid all-time excessive additionally has a draw back, because the free market rapidly eradicated weaker gamers and led to a near-total monopoly.
Actuality behind the $4.13 billion RWA growth
Infrastructure venture xyz has captured nearly full management over liquidity on Hyperliquid, accumulating $4.12 billion of the whole $4.13 billion. Amid this, smaller deployers are barely holding a modest $15 million to $20 million, whereas one of many ecosystem’s pioneers, the Felix protocol, has already formally introduced the closure of its markets.
Such harsh circumstances are defined by the platform’s tokenomics, as a significant participant should lock 500 million HYPE tokens as collateral to launch a buying and selling interface, whereas half of the charges generated are directed towards HYPE buybacks.
The explosive development of the RWA sector has demonstrated that round the clock inventory buying and selling on blockchain rails is not a hypothetical experiment, however a mature market with billions of {dollars} in turnover.
Nevertheless, because it continues to scale, the decentralized trade should deal with a basic problem — develop an ecosystem during which just about all actual liquidity is concentrated within the arms of a single monopolist.
